Title
An optimization-based approach for the planning of energy flexible production processes with integrated energy storage scheduling
Abstract
Due to the fluctuating energy supply of renewable energy systems, electricity prices on the markets are becoming increasingly volatile. This offers manufacturers opportunities to reduce costs by adapting production processes to the energy supply. So-called energy flexible factories are thus a decisive competitive factor and at the same time a solution component for a successful energy turnaround. The implementation of energy flexible factories requires energy-oriented production planning that makes appropriate use of flexibility measures. Energy storage systems supplement companies' flexibility options. In order to be able to use them cost-optimally, interactions with flexible production processes must be taken into account and planned. This paper introduces an optimization-based approach for the integrated planning of flexible production processes and battery storage scheduling.
